Where does “ασπροπρόσωπος” come from?
ασπροπρόσωπος (Greek) comes from Greek πρόσωπο, from Ancient Greek πρόσωπον, from Ancient Greek ὤψ, from Proto-Hellenic ókʷs, from Proto-Indo-European h₃ókʷs, from Proto-Indo-European h₃ekʷ- — to see; eye.
ασπροπρόσωπος (Greek): white-faced
